buying from a vendor
the alcomest on the floating docks are the only people that will sell it.
there are 2 one in tram and one in fel
they are a comidity item so the price keeps going up it started around 10 or so and now
the tram one is over over 500 gold ea
the fell one is close to 300 gold ea
now to keep this in mind it takes
6 salt peter per black powder and 4 black powder per heavy charge
which comes to 24 salt peter per heavy charge
so needless to say its going to cost thousands of gold per shot
if you are buying it
if tram is at exactly 500 salt peter it will cost 12k gold to fire a single cannon shot
and with my best round to disable a pirate ship 9 shots will cost
108k at best
my average is 14 shots which is 168k on average to disable a pirate ship
if fel is at 300 gold then
7200 per shot
64,800 best case
100,800 on average

I've been saltpeter mining like crazy the last 4 days.
I get about 1600 saltpeter per hour doing this technique ...
Go to Ilsh, find a shrine with no spawn, and areas with lots of mountain and little to no spawn ...
then the trick is to just speed mine as I call it ....
hit once, move about 6 steps along mountain, hit again, keep repeating till you get the red message (its red for me using Pincos UI anyways, might be diff in 2d etc) ...
that tells you that you have struck miter. Sometimes its hidden in the mountain, sometimes its out in plain view. if its hidden, just use left control-shift and click on the word to highlight its bar. Then target the bar till its gone (it drops in size as you go and you have to retarget again with each new size).
Luck is extremely important. With no luck I got huge niters with about 70-90 saltpeter. With 1400 luck I got gigantic niters with about 200 or more saltpeter.
Oh and yes you get this same chance in Ilsh caves like the one west of Compassion (going to twisted weild I believe). Remember you can hit the ground in dungeons and caves too, so dont leave the open areas untouched.

oh forgot to mention, the reason I speed mine for saltpeter is if you get a hit, it will be on the first try (as long as you have gm mining).
I didnt try to use mining gloves to see if that would help, because that would drop my luck in order to trade gloves.
Oh and have a macro set to all follow me if you ride a beetle to carry stuff, and have an arch cure also set as a macro. If your beetle gets attacked by spawn, and is poisoned, you cant ride it till its cured. I yell all follow me repeatedly and jump on the beetle even if its loaded with ore to save it since I can live much longer vs the low to mid level spawn in Ilsh where I mine.
Also watch your weight and be sure to transfer the one ore you get each time to the beetle before you get overloaded and cant move (in case you get attacked by spawn).
Oh and lastly remember not to try to run while on a weighted down beetle, just walk and you should be able to outwalk most spawn that might attack.

oh and the niter spawns after 5 minutes, not in the same spot, so you can go to most places and can keep looping around to speed mine to find more niter.
